What Are Restaurant Recipe Cards

If you’re wondering “what is a recipe card?,” the chances are high that you already know. For generations, people have preserved family recipes by writing them down on cue cards and passing them on to worthy descendents. This practice captures all the details needed to ensure a dish always tastes the same, whether it was served by Great-Aunt Marge in 1982 or your 20-something cousin in 2025.

Restaurant recipe cards fulfill the same purpose on a bigger scale. They’re standardized, easy-to-follow documents that outline how to prepare a dish from start to finish. These cards are designed to give your kitchen staff the clear directions they need to prepare every dish consistently, efficiently, and safely. And when used carefully, they can also help control portions, reduce waste, and speed up new hire training. They’re also an excellent source of information when you’re working out how to cost out a recipe.

Benefits of a Restaurant Recipe Card

You know how to use a recipe card template now, but maybe you’re still wondering, ‘what is a recipe card good for?’ If so, you should know there are plenty of good reasons to incorporate restaurant cards into your kitchen operations. Here are just a few of the benefits.

Train Staff Faster

Instead of shadowing someone else for hours or days, new hires can prepare the same quality dishes as seasoned staff, simply by following a clear, step-by-step guide. That means they spend less time training – and more time serving meals to delighted diners.

Maintain Consistency and Quality

Guests expect the same experience every time they visit. With a recipe card, your signature burger will taste just as amazing on Tuesday night as it did on Sunday.

Eliminate Guesswork

You’ll never hear, “I thought it was two tablespoons” again. Restaurant recipe cards ensure team members always know the correct portions, procedures, and plating standards.

Reduce food waste

Standardized prep means fewer mistakes, more precise portions, and more informed ingredient orders. Over time, it all adds up to serious savings.
